Allowance for Expected Credit Losses & Non-Credit Related Impairment Costs The Company evaluates AFS securities for impairment when fair value is below amortized cost on a quarterly basis. If the Company intends to sell or will be required to sell the security before its anticipated recovery, the full amount of the impairment loss is charged to net income (loss) and included in net investment gains (losses). If the Company does not intend to sell or will not be required to sell the security before its anticipated recovery, an allowance for expected credit losses is established and the portion of the loss relating to credit factors is recorded in net income (loss). The non-credit impairment amount of the loss (which could be related to interest rates and/or market conditions) is recognized in other comprehensive income ("OCI"). To estimate the allowance for expected credit losses for most of the AFS securities, the Company analyzes projected cash flows which are primarily driven by assumptions regarding loss severity, probability of default and projected recovery rates. The Company's determination of default and loss severity rates are based on credit rating, credit analysis and macroeconomic forecasts. Unrealized losses on securities issued or backed, either explicitly or implicitly by the U.S. government are not analyzed for credit losses. The Company has concluded that any possibility of a credit loss on these securities is highly unlikely due to the explicit U.S. government guarantee related to certain securities (e.g., Government National Mortgage Association issuances) and the implicit guarantee related to other securities that has been validated by past actions (e.g., U.S. government bailout of Federal National Mortgage Association and Federal Home Loan Mortgage Corporation during the 2008 credit crisis). Although these securities are not analyzed for credit losses, they are evaluated for impairment based on the Company's intention to sell and likely requirement to sell. Based on the Company's analysis at June 30, 2026, net unrealized gains on the Company’s AFS fixed maturity securities were due to non-credit factors and were expected to be recovered as the related securities approach maturity. At June 30, 2026, the Company did not intend to sell the securities in an unrealized loss position and it is not more likely than not that the Company will be required to sell these securities before the anticipated recovery of their amortized costs. Therefore, no allowance was recorded for expected credit losses on the Company's portfolio of AFS fixed maturity securities for the three and six months ended June 30, 2026 and 2025, respectively. 4. (1)Ratings above are based on Standard & Poor’s ("S&P"), or equivalent, ratings. b)Other Investments, Equity Securities and Equity Method Investments Certain of the Company's other investments and equity method investments are subject to restrictions on redemptions and sales that are determined by the governing documents, which could limit our ability to liquidate those investments. These restrictions may include lock-ups, redemption gates, restricted share classes, restrictions on the frequency of redemption and notice periods. A gate is the ability to deny or delay a redemption request. Certain other investments and equity method investments may not have any restrictions governing their sale, but there is no active market and no assurance that the Company will be able to execute a sale in a timely manner. In addition, even if certain other investments and equity method investments are not eligible for redemption or sales are restricted, we may still receive income distributions from those investments. Equity Method Investments The equity method investments include real estate investments accounted for under the equity method and other investments measured at fair value. The equity method investments include limited partnerships which are variable interests issued by variable interest entities ("VIEs"). The Company is not the primary beneficiary of these VIEs as it does not have the power to direct the activities that are most significant to the economic performance of these VIEs. The Company is deemed to have limited influence over the operating and financial policies of the investee and accordingly, these investments are reported under the equity method of accounting. In applying the equity method of accounting, the investments are initially recorded at cost and are subsequently adjusted based on the Company’s proportionate share of the investee's net income or loss. Generally, the maximum exposure to loss on these interests is limited to the amount of commitment made by the Company as more fully described in "Note 11 - Commitments, Contingencies and Guarantees" in these condensed consolidated financial statements.
